I was creating a 4 gig fat32 on the laptop, and during the resizing of the
primary ntfs, it crashed with an error.  I had to boot to the recovery
console and run chkdsk to fix the XP laptop.  Interestingly, this is a known
issue, as I found the instructions on Symantec's site when I googled the
error from another machine. All was ok afterwards, but I have heard horror
stories about PQ Magic from others.  You need to have a backout plan when
you use the program, but it is so handy.  Since the tool cannot be trusted
to never fail, it may be much easier to just backup, delete, create,
restore.

No its not possible.


However you can backup your installed distro on one parititon to another,
then use fdisk to delete that partition, and create an extended one instead,
then fill that with logical partitions, then restore the backup to the
target partition.  Finally you will have to bend the filesystem you restore
to make it smaller.

I suggest you just nuke one partition and reinstall what was there later.
